Domain-Specific Memory
Memory that applies to a particular area of knowledge or expertise, allowing for better recall of information related to that field.
Problem Representation
The process of mentally framing or defining a problem in a way that will facilitate the search for solutions.
Analogy
A comparison between two things, typically for the purpose of explanation or clarification.
Retrieval Cue
A stimulus, whether external or internal, that helps in the recall or recognition of memory stored information.
